 > [RexB] I also have a question for you and Peter, whom I am
 > copying, could I shop this to media, for no remuneration?    (01)

[ppy] my take: as far as Ontolog is concerned, its IPR policy 
(ref: http://ontolog.cim3.net/cgi-bin/wiki.pl?WikiHomePage#nid32) 
should rule.    (02)

That said, I personally do want to see that community members do 
end up 'gaining (both intellectually, opportunistically, 
commercially, financially, ...) from their engagement with this 
CoP -- I trust that (to provide continuous value to its 
constituency) being the only way the CoP can be sustainable.    (03)

That said, may I suggest that we have (a) an open, community 
sanctioned summary report of the 8/25 session that will be 
published by Ontolog, goes into its archives, gets used as the 
community submission to the Fed HIT Conference, ...etc. But then, 
since authors actually hold the copyrights (not Ontolog ... 
Ontolog just stipulates that they should carry an open content 
license), you guys could re-factor that and shop it elsewhere 
(gratis, or for remuneration, as you see fit) as long as proper 
attributed is made (to Ontolog and the other contributors, namely 
Ontolog, the panelists, and those participating in the discussion 
and discourse.)    (04)
